It’s confession time. I’ve always wanted brighter teeth. I know it’s a very vain sounding thing but let me explain. We have to go back to when I was 16. Driving home from school one afternoon I got a little sidetracked and hit a tree (no I’m not brave enough to share exactly why I hit the tree). Nothing was harmed in the wreck except that I hit my front tooth on the steering wheel and it promptly died.
Random little fact for you, but if a tooth dies nicely it’s like having a root canal with no pain. The tooth is perfectly fine and still in my head many years later (note I’m sharing dates either…) The only negative effect is that the tooth slowly darkens overtime. This has messed with my head a lot and thus the long standing desire to whiten my teeth.
Occasionally on a super good deal I’ve tried the store strips only to see no difference, but doing anything more powerful is not in the budget.
Custom at-home whitening gel trays can cost around $500. Recently though I was contacted by Smile Brilliant to see if I wanted to try out their program! How could I say no? This is like a trip to disney world for a 5 year old. Of course I’ll try it out!!
First, I was excited that these weren’t just strips they were molded trays made just for me. They sent in the mail everything I needed to make the impressions. The process was simple, and I sent my impressions back off so they could make the trays. A few days later, the trays arrived at my doorstep! Along the way, they were always good about emailing me the updates of when they received my impressions and when everything was sent off.


I gave the trays a 5-day test. I started whitening them this past Friday and I was really happy with the results that I got from only 5 days of whitening. The idea of at-home custom trays may seem intimidating, but trust me, it was so easy. The quality of the after picture isn’t that great, but the discoloration is barely noticeable! I have enough gel to do another 10 days too.
